4- Chicago Bulls vs. 5- Brooklyn Nets, 2-1 Bulls lead season series

A rematch of last year’s quarterfinals matchup, in which the Bulls won a Game 7 at the Barclays Center without Derrick Rose. Both teams rank in the top 10 in terms of points allowed and you would think each game would be close down the stretch. Joakim Noah vs Kevin Garnett (if healthy) is going to be an intriguing matchup to follow if you can remember the games when Noah played against Garnett when he was in Boston. Would this series go seven games again?
